Verses Extract from

Great Strength Bodhisattva’s Perfect Penetration

 

Truly recognize your own faults,

                   And don’t discuss the faults of others.

                   Others’ faults are just my own;

                   Being of one substance with all is called

                             great compassion.

 

(The  Great Strength Bodhisattva’s perfect Penetration ; A Simple Explanation by the Venerable Master Hsuan Hua; page  17)

     

          Being mindful of the Buddha to the point that

                   one’s mind is uninterrupted,

          Reciting “Amitabha” to the point that one’s mind

                   meshes with the sound of the word,

          When distracting thoughts no longer arise,

                   samadhi is attained;

          One can surely expect rebirth in the Pure Land.

          Utterly weary of the afflictions of the Saha World,

          One breaks all attachments to the mundane

                   world and

          Intently seeks rebirth in Ultimate Bliss.

          Once defiled thinking is set aside,

          One returns to pure thought.

         

(The  Great Strength Bodhisattva’s perfect Penetration ; A Simple Explanation by the Venerable Master Hsuan Hua; page  19)

 

          When not even a single thought arises,

                   The entire substance manifests.

          When the six sense faculties suddenly stir,

                   one is covered by clouds.

 

(The  Great Strength Bodhisattva’s perfect Penetration ; A Simple Explanation by the Venerable Master Hsuan Hua; page  19 & 20)

          Fish roe, amra flowers, and

          Bodhisattvas of initial resolve:

          They abound in great number on the

                   causal ground,

          Yet only a handful will reach fruition.

 

(The  Great Strength Bodhisattva’s perfect Penetration ; A Simple Explanation by the Venerable Master Hsuan Hua; page  34)

 

      Water makes no sound streaming along level ground;

          Noisily it resonates when encountering the highs and

                   lows of the land.

          Without uttering a word, the Great Way pervades the

                   Dharma Realm;

          Out of greed, hatred, and stupidity, contention arises.

 

(The  Great Strength Bodhisattva’s perfect Penetration ; A Simple Explanation by the Venerable Master Hsuan Hua; page  35)
